POSITION SUMMARY

The Financial Analyst provides support to the local management team that may include, but is not limited to financial reporting and control, income management, debt management, submitting invoices for payment for Accounts Payable and accurately billing clients for services rendered.

As part of the DSV team, Associates are expected to meet company objectives in the areas of performance, safety, and quality. Associates are expected to comply with all corporate and site-specific policies.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Play a significant role in the accurate and timely preparation of internal financial reporting and analysis. Analyzes records of present and past operations, trends and costs, estimated and realized revenues, administrative commitments, and obligations incurred to project future revenues and expenses
  • Reporting of actual results and analysis vs. plan
  • Assist operations regarding cost budgets, quarterly forecasts and other financial planning activities
  • Publish periodic financial reports, including but not limited to : accounts payable, freight and consumable metrics, to provide department owners and leadership visibility to financial results
  • Perform analytical reviews of financial information to identify trends / opportunities. Recommend improvements to drive cost efficiencies in balance with operational needs and capabilities
  • Produce cost quotes, strategic business cases, risk assessment and other ad-hoc analysis in support of the business
  • Participate in special projects as required, including process improvement and financial tools development and implementation
  • Management of financial process improvements, Key Performance Indicators and tracking of strategic initiatives
  • Support of various internal and external financial and system audits
  • Plan, organize and manage own workload to ensure your contribution to the company's monthly financial reporting process is achieved in a timely and accurate manner
  • Ensure swift payment of invoices
  • Collect and confirm accuracy of all charges and expenses for a file to be billed
  • Manage Accounts Payable process : coordinate purchasing and tracking of vendor invoices through the system and associated revenue accruals
  • Financial : Month-end close responsibilities : journal entries, corporate submissions, expense management, budgetary support for cost centers and ad hoc analysis.
  • Prepare month-end journal entries - focused on cost accruals
  • Complete the monthly Client Profitability Model
  • Order and maintain inventory of office supplies
  • Attend meetings as required, documentation & distribution of meeting minutes, etc.
  • Handle sensitive and confidential information in a professional, mature, discreet and secure manner
  • Create and disseminate various communications & reports
  • Creates or Assists with the design and development of presentations
  • Effectively communicate with employees, customers, suppliers & others on behalf of site management
  • Scheduling and meeting with vendors to ensure competitive pricing is maintained
  • Work with Operations team to develop Budgets and Forecast for Financial performance

SKILLS & ABILITIES

Education & Experience :

  • A Bachelor's degree is required, preferably within the area of Accounting or Finance
  • A minimum of 5 years of accounting, FP&A or finance experience is required
  • Computer Skills :

  • Candidate must possess intermediate to advanced Microsoft Excel skills required (i.e. Pivot Tables, Formulas, VLOOKUP functions)
  • Certificates & Licenses : N / A

    Language Skills English (reading, writing, verbal)

    Mathematical Skills

  • Strong Math skills with focused attention to detail
  • Other Skills

  • The candidate must possess the ability to partner with associates at all levels of the organization
  • Strong communication, presentation, interpersonal, and influencing skills are required
  • This position requires a highly motivated individual with strong analytical skills, intellectual curiosity and proven leadership skills
  • The ability to work well in a dynamic environment, think creatively and be able to recommend and implement process improvements, work independently and handle multiple tasks simultaneously is required
